UI Cyclists Honored as Top Team

 

The American Diabetes Association recently honored 19 bicyclists representing The United Illuminating Company, who raised more than $30,000 to find a cure for the debilitating disease.

 

Team UI was named top team in the 2007 Tour de Cure cycling event, sponsored by the ADA’s Connecticut/Western Massachusetts office. The cyclists, including 13 employees and six friends and family members, rode routes ranging from 25 kilometers to 100 miles in the June 2 event. This marks the eighth consecutive year UI has participated in the Tour.

 

The ADA’s Jim MacFarlane visited UI recently to present a plaque of appreciation to participants.

 

“Thanks to all who participated in the 2007 Tour de Cure,” MacFarlane said. “I am really pleased that we exceeded last year’s contributions and were once again the No. 1 fund-raising team,” said Joseph Thomas, UI’s vice president for client fulfillment and Team UI captain.

The American Diabetes Association is the nation’s premier voluntary health organization supporting diabetes research, information and advocacy. Diabetes affects the body’s ability to produce or respond properly to insulin, a hormone that allows blood sugar to enter the cells of the body and be used for energy.  Nearly 21 million U.S. children and adults have diabetes.  It is the fifth deadliest disease in the United States and it has no cure.

 

The United Illuminating Company (UI) is a New Haven-based regional distribution utility established in 1899.  UI is engaged in the purchase, transmission, distribution and sale of electricity and related services to more than 320,000 residential, commercial and industrial customers in the Greater New Haven and Bridgeport areas.
